What Is Compression Depth?
Compression deepness describes just how deep you push down on the upper body during mouth-to-mouth resuscitation. The American Heart Association (AHA) advises a compression depth of a minimum of 2 inches (5 cm) for adults, while youngsters call for slightly less. Nevertheless, a lower compression depth-- while easier for rescuers-- can cause inadequate blood flow to vital organs.
Lower Compression Deepness: Why It Issues in Life Support
The Scientific research Behind Efficient Compressions
Research has shown that much deeper compressions are much more reliable at creating blood flow during heart attack. When compressions are as well superficial, the heart may not sufficiently replenish with blood between compressions, resulting in decreased perfusion pressure-- a vital factor for survival.

What Are Public Defibrillators?
Public Access Defibrillators (PADs) are devices put in area areas to provide immediate therapy for unexpected cardiac arrest sufferers prior to EMS gets here. They provide an electrical shock to restore regular heart rhythm.
How Public Defibrillators Enhance Survival Rates
Studies show that very early defibrillation incorporated with correct CPR substantially boosts survival results:
- Rapid Reaction Chance: Accessing PADs can conserve valuable minutes. User-Friendly Layout: The majority of public defibrillators supply step-by-step voice prompts for users.

Taking Turns on Compressions: Preserving Effectiveness
The Relevance of Turning Rescuers
Fatigue is a substantial factor impacting mouth-to-mouth resuscitation high quality in time; thus taking turns on compressions becomes crucial:
Maintain Top quality: Revolving every two minutes maintains compressions effective. Prevent Rescuer Fatigue: Make certain each participant remains fresh throughout the resuscitation process.Slow Compression Price vs Fast Compressions
Finding the Right Balance
While it's essential not to hurry compressions, being extremely sluggish can also be damaging:
Aim for 100-- 120 compressions per minute. Use tunes like "Stayin' Alive" by Bee Gees as a rhythmic guide!Balancing speed ensures adequate blood circulation without compromising method quality.
